What affects the price

When you budget for new windows, several factors change the final number. The material you choose—like vinyl, wood, or fiberglass—is usually the biggest driver. You will also see price shifts based on the style of window, such as double-hung versus large picture windows, and the specific energy-efficiency ratings you select. The size of the opening and the complexity of the installation, especially if the existing frames need repair, will also adjust the total. We determine the ex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

Contractors are the professionals who execute the removal of old windows and the precise fitment of new ones. You need a contractor when you want a professional finish that warranties the work and ensures a tight seal against the elements. They are responsible for measuring accurately, preparing the rough opening, and installing flashing to protect against moisture. Hiring a professional contractor ensures your windows perform as intended for years without needing constant adjustments or repairs.
